I’m loving this thread and all the stories. It’s been fun and therapeutic. I think I mentioned that AA son’s offensive struggles began in mid July. Ironically, in the middle of the struggle he was called up to AAA. He continued his offensive struggles, did well defensively, and 2 weeks later went back to AA. A top prospect had been promoted to fill his AA spot, so when he returned there was juggling of positions. He was all over the board mentally, and it was tough on everyone, trying to determine what to say and how to support him. I’ve read how this road is not linear. This was his first big setback. He refocused his efforts, and found joy being back with his guys in AA. You could see and hear him slowly finding his way and beginning to hit his stride. Gratefully, after Sunday’s game, he was called back up to AAA. After 2 games, he’s 4 for 8. While he’s feeling pretty good, his focus is staying within his game, NOT PRESSING, enjoying getting on base (even with bloop hits), and simplifying. For this second call up, he has been a little more grounded. Each day we are learning more about this game that we are fortunate to be a part of. It’s great to have this group supporting us all.
